1、更换DNS服务器
手动更改DNS服务器地址:当默认的DNS服务器出现问题时,更换为其他可靠的DNS服务器是一种直接有效的解决方法,用户可以进入网络设置,选择适配器选项,然后修改协议版本4的DNS设置为公共DNS,如Google Public DNS(8.8.8.8 和 8.8.4.4)或Cloudflare DNS(1.1.1.1),这种方法的优点在于增强了DNS解析的稳定性和速度,但需要用户有一定的网络设置知识。
2、清空DNS缓存
刷新DNS解析缓存:DNS解析缓存存储了最近查询的DNS信息,有时旧的或错误的信息可能导致DNS解析失败,通过在命令提示符(管理员模式)执行ipconfig /flushdns
命令,可以清除这些缓存信息,迫使系统重新获取最新的DNS信息,这个方法适用于快速解决因缓存错误导致的DNS问题。
3、检查网络设置
确认网络配置正确:错误的网络设置是引起DNS异常的常见原因,检查IP地址是否正确分配,子网掩码、默认网关以及DNS服务器地址是否设置正确,确保网络适配器的属性配置无误,并且没有多余的、不必要的网络服务,此方法有助于排除配置错误引起的DNS问题。
4、更新网络驱动程序
保持网络设备驱动最新:过时或损坏的网络驱动程序可能导致DNS解析失败,通过设备管理器检查和更新网络适配器的驱动程序至最新版本,可以有效避免由此引起的DNS异常,这一方法对于硬件兼容性或驱动软件问题导致的DNS故障尤为有效。
5、重置网络设置
恢复网络设置为默认状态:在Windows系统中,可以使用“网络重置”功能来还原网络设置到初始状态,这将清除所有网络配置,包括WiFi密码、VPN设置等,这一操作对于解决由复杂或未知的网络设置变更引起的问题是一个可行的解决方案,但执行前需确保备份相关配置信息。
6、使用网络疑难解答
利用系统内置的诊断工具:Windows系统提供的网络疑难解答工具能够自动检测和修复常见的网络问题,包括DNS相关问题,通过“设置”>“更新与安全”>“疑难解答”运行网络疑难解答,根据指引完成修复步骤,这种方法适合不太熟悉手动设置的用户,操作简单且具有一定的问题解决能力。
7、联系网络服务提供商
寻求ISP支持:如果上述方法均未能解决问题,可能需要联系互联网服务提供商(ISP),DNS问题有时可能源于ISP端的设置或服务问题,专业的技术支持能够帮助诊断和解决更为复杂的网络问题。
结合上述内容,可以看到修复DNS异常的方法多样,用户可根据自己的情况选择合适的修复策略,在解决问题的过程中,还需要注意以下几个关键点:
在更改任何网络设置之前,确保备份当前的网络配置,以便在必要时可以恢复。
使用公共DNS服务时,应选择信誉良好的服务提供者,以保证网络安全和隐私。
定期检查和更新操作系统及驱动程序,以防止由软件过时引起的网络问题。
为了进一步帮助用户解决DNS相关的问题,以下是两个常见问题及其解答:
Q1: 更换DNS服务器后依然无法上网怎么办?
A1: 如果更换DNS服务器后问题依旧存在,建议先清空DNS缓存,再次尝试连接,同时检查防火墙或安全软件设置是否阻止了DNS请求,必要时可以尝试临时禁用这些软件进行测试。
Q2: 网络疑难解答工具没有发现任何问题但DNS仍异常怎么办?
A2: 如果网络疑难解答工具未发现问题,可能需要手动进行更深入的检查,此时可以尝试重置网络设置或联系ISP寻求帮助,检查是否有第三方软件冲突或进行系统还原也可能有助于解决问题。
电脑DNS异常是一个常见的网络问题,但通过上述介绍的方法通常可以有效解决,用户在遇到此类问题时,应根据具体情况选择合适的修复策略,并注意保护个人网络安全和隐私,通过细致的排查和正确的操作步骤,大多数DNS异常问题都能够被顺利解决。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/8449.html